Zum Inhalt springen
JTL-Wawi

JTL-Wawi MCP Server: So nutzen KI-Agents Ihre Warenwirtschaftsdaten

Mit SQL2REST verbinden Sie KI-Tools wie Claude und ChatGPT direkt mit Ihrer JTL-Wawi Datenbank. Read-only, lokal, DSGVO-konform.

Lesezeit: 5 min
SQL2REST Team
Inhaltsverzeichnis

Das Model Context Protocol (MCP) von Anthropic ermöglicht es KI-Agenten, strukturiert auf externe Datenquellen zuzugreifen. Mit einem JTL-Wawi MCP Server können Sie Tools wie Claude, ChatGPT oder Cursor direkt an Ihre JTL-Wawi Datenbank anbinden. Dieser Artikel erklärt die Architektur, die Einrichtung und die praktischen Einsatzmöglichkeiten für E-Commerce Unternehmen und Entwickler.

Wichtiger Hinweis: SQL2REST bietet ausschließlich read-only Zugriff auf Ihre JTL-Wawi Daten. Schreiboperationen sind nicht möglich. Sämtliche KI-Abfragen über den MCP-Server sind daher rein lesend und können Ihre Datenbank nicht verändern.

Was ist ein MCP Server und warum ist er für JTL-Wawi relevant?

MCP steht für Model Context Protocol, einen offenen Standard von Anthropic. Er definiert, wie KI-Agenten auf externe Datenquellen und Tools zugreifen können, ohne dass Entwickler für jede Anbindung custom Code schreiben müssen. Der MCP-Server fungiert als Schnittstelle zwischen dem KI-Modell und der Datenquelle.

Für JTL-Wawi Benutzer bedeutet das: Statt manuell Berichte zu erstellen oder SQL-Abfragen zu formulieren, können Sie einem KI-Agenten in natürlicher Sprache Fragen stellen. Der Agent greift über den MCP Server automatisch auf Ihre JTL-Wawi Datenbank zu und liefert die Antwort. Ob Bestandsverwaltung, Retourenmanagement oder Power BI-Reporting - die Anwendungsmöglichkeiten sind vielfältig.

API-Architektur: Vom SQL Server zur JTL-Wawi Datenbank

Die API-Architektur eines JTL-Wawi MCP Servers besteht aus vier Schichten:

  1. JTL-Wawi Datenbank (MS SQL Server) - Ihre bestehende Warenwirtschaft mit allen Artikeln, Aufträgen und Kundendaten
  2. SQL2REST - ein lokaler Windows Service mit integriertem MCP-Server, der die Datenbank als REST API und via MCP bereitstellt
  3. KI-Agent (Claude Desktop, ChatGPT, Cursor) - der Benutzer interagiert hier in natürlicher Sprache

SQL2REST übernimmt die Schnittstellenentwicklung zwischen Ihrer JTL-Wawi Datenbank und dem MCP-Server. Die Implementierung läuft lokal auf Ihrem Server, sodass keine Daten an externe Dienste übertragen werden. Das macht die Lösung DSGVO-konform. Die Authentifizierung erfolgt über einen API-Schlüssel, den Sie im Admin-Bereich hinterlegen.

SQL2REST als REST API für JTL-Wawi einrichten

SQL2REST installiert sich als Windows Service und erkennt Ihre JTL-Wawi Datenbank per Auto-Discovery Wizard automatisch. Nach der Registrierung und Konfiguration stellt der Service eine vollständige REST API mit OpenAPI/Swagger-Dokumentation bereit. Die Latenz liegt bei 50-200ms pro Abfrage.

Unterstützt werden alle JTL Editionen: Start, Advanced, Pro und Enterprise. Ebenso funktioniert SQL2REST mit JTL-Wawi v1.5, v1.6+ und dem neuen v2.0. Der Administrator kann mehrere Mandanten anbinden und über die URL verschiedene Datenbestände ansteuern. Die bereitgestellte API-Referenz im Swagger-Format ist Postman-ready und erleichtert Entwicklern die Integration. Die Developer-Community profitiert zusätzlich von der offenen REST-Schnittstelle, die sich mit gängigen APIs, SDKs und Resources integrieren lässt. Der integrierte MCP-Server nutzt das stdio-Protokoll und benötigt keine zusätzliche Konfiguration.

SQL2REST Preise für JTL (Early Bird)

Die aktuellen Preise sind Early-Bird-Konditionen und können sich ändern:

  • Personal: 39 Euro/Monat (1 Mandant)
  • Agency: 99 Euro/Monat (bis zu 5 Mandanten)
  • 30 Tage kostenlos testen - keine Kreditkarte erforderlich

MCP-Server Authentifizierung und Konfiguration mit SQL2REST

Sobald SQL2REST läuft, können Sie den MCP Server einrichten. In der Konfigurationsdatei Ihres KI-Clients (z.B. Claude Desktop, Cursor oder Windsurf) tragen Sie den Pfad zur sql2rest.exe mit dem Flag --mcp ein. Der integrierte MCP-Server liest die Konfiguration automatisch aus der config.ini und stellt 12 Tools bereit: Kunden suchen, Aufträge filtern, Rechnungen abrufen, Lagerbestände prüfen, Produkte abfragen und mehr.

Da SQL2REST ausschließlich read-only arbeitet, ist die Berechtigung klar begrenzt: Der KI-Agent kann Daten auslesen, aber niemals verändern. Dieses Feature ist standardmäßig deaktiviert für Schreibzugriff und lässt sich nicht umgehen. Für Workflows, die Schreibzugriff erfordern, müssten Sie auf die offizielle JTL-Wawi API zurückgreifen. Bei der App-Registrierung für externe Zugriffe konfigurieren Sie den Port benutzerdefinierten Anforderungen entsprechend.

Automatische Workflows und Speicher Methoden für JTL-Wawi

Ein JTL-Wawi MCP Server eröffnet zahlreiche Möglichkeiten, E-Commerce-Prozesse automatisieren und effizient verbessern zu können:

  • Bestandsabfragen: "Welche Artikel haben weniger als 10 Stück auf Lager?" - der Agent durchsucht automatisch die Materialwirtschaft
  • Auftragsanalyse: "Zeige alle offenen Aufträge der letzten 7 Tage" - ideal für tägliches Monitoring mit PRTG oder Zabbix
  • Kundenrecherche: "Finde alle Bestellungen von Kunde X" - ohne manuelles Suchen in der Wawi
  • Reporting: Automatische Zusammenfassungen für Umsatz, Retouren oder Lagerbestände
  • Entwickler-Tools: Code-Assistenten wie Cursor können JTL-Daten direkt in Entwicklungs-Workflows einbinden

Diese Arbeitsabläufe sparen Zeit und reduzieren Fehler, weil der KI-Agent die Daten direkt aus der JTL-Wawi Datenbank bezieht, statt auf manuelle Exporte angewiesen zu sein. Für die Leitung der Entwicklungsabteilung bietet SQL2REST eine schnelle Evaluationsmöglichkeit ohne aufwendiges Onboarding.

JTL-Wawi API vs. SQL2REST MCP-Server im Vergleich

Die offizielle JTL-Wawi API befindet sich derzeit in der Beta-Phase und ist kostenlos. Ob und wann sich die Preisstruktur ändert, ist noch nicht endgültig kommuniziert. Laut aktueller Preisliste sind nach der Beta folgende Kosten vorgesehen: Advanced 199 Euro/Monat API-Addon, Pro 99 Euro/Monat. Bei JTL Enterprise ist die API inklusive, bei JTL Start gibt es keinen API-Zugang.

Kriterium JTL API (Beta) SQL2REST + MCP
Zugriff Read & Write Read-Only
Kosten Beta: kostenlos, danach 99-199 Euro/Monat Ab 39 Euro/Monat (Early Bird)
JTL Editionen Advanced, Pro, Enterprise Alle (inkl. Start)
MCP-fähig Nein (Erweiterung nötig) Ja, integriert (--mcp Flag)
Installation Cloud/Plugin Lokaler Windows Service
Datensicherung Abhängig von JTL Lokal, DSGVO-konform

Für E-Commerce Unternehmen, die primär Daten zugreifen und auslesen möchten, etwa für Shopware-Anbindungen, JTL-Shop-Integrationen oder Webanwendungen, ist SQL2REST die kostengünstigere Erweiterung. Wer Schreibzugriff benötigt, kommt an der offiziellen JTL-Wawi API nicht vorbei.

Häufige Fragen zum JTL-Wawi MCP Server

Welche Schnittstelle verwendet JTL-Wawi?

JTL-Wawi bietet eine offizielle REST-API (aktuell Beta) für Lese- und Schreibzugriff. Zusätzlich lässt sich über SQL2REST eine Read-Only REST API direkt aus der MS SQL Server Datenbank generieren, die auch als MCP Server für KI-Agenten dient. Historisch nutzt JTL Wawi auch XML-basierte Speicher Methoden, APIs und SDKs sowie Resources für die Schnittstellenentwicklung. Für Monitoring-Zwecke können Tools wie PRTG oder Zabbix die Checks auf dem Servers übernehmen.

Ist der MCP Server kostenlos?

SQL2REST bietet eine 30-tägige kostenlose Testphase. Danach kostet der Service ab 39 Euro/Monat (Early Bird). Die JTL-Wawi API ist während der Beta-Phase kostenlos, danach fallen 99-199 Euro/Monat an. SQL2REST hat den MCP-Server direkt integriert. Mit dem Flag --mcp startet die Software im MCP-Modus und stellt 12 Tools bereit, darunter Kunden-, Auftrags- und Bestandsabfragen.

Welche IP-Adresse muss der JTL-Wawi-Server haben?

Für den MCP Server mit SQL2REST genügt eine lokale IP-Adresse im Netzwerk, da SQL2REST als Desktop-Dienst auf demselben Server oder im selben Netzwerk wie die JTL-Wawi Datenbank läuft. Eine öffentliche IP ist nicht erforderlich.

Wie kann ich JTL-Wawi mit DHL verbinden?

Die DHL-Anbindung erfolgt über JTL-Shipping oder JTL-eazyAuction, nicht über den MCP Server. Der MCP Server eignet sich hingegen, um Versanddaten automatisch abzufragen und in KI-gestützte JTL-Workflows einzubinden.

Wie verbinde ich JTL-Wawi mit JTL-POS?

Die Verbindung zwischen JTL-Wawi und JTL-POS läuft über die integrierte JTL-WMS-Schnittstelle. Der MCP Server kann ergänzend genutzt werden, um POS-Daten aus der Wawi für Analysen auszulesen. Auch benutzerdefinierten Auswertungen sind so möglich.

Fazit: JTL-Wawi MCP Server mit SQL2REST einrichten

Ein MCP Server für JTL-Wawi macht überall dort Sinn, wo Sie regelmäßig Daten aus Ihrer Warenwirtschaft automatisch abfragen und in Workflows einbinden möchten. Mit SQL2REST als Grundlage lässt sich die Anbindung in wenigen Minuten einrichten, funktioniert mit allen JTL Editionen und bleibt durch die lokale Installation DSGVO-konform.

Die Kombination aus SQL2REST und MCP ermöglicht es, KI-Agenten wie Claude oder ChatGPT als intelligente Assistenten für Ihr E-Commerce-Geschäft zu nutzen. Ob Bestandsverwaltung, Auftragsanalyse oder automatisches Reporting: Statt manueller Datenbankabfragen stellen Sie einfach eine Frage in natürlicher Sprache. Benutzer können so auf bereitgestellte Daten zugreifen, ohne SQL-Kenntnisse zu benötigen. Dank Pagination lassen sich auch umfangreiche Datenbestände über 1 Mio Einträge strukturiert abfragen.

Testen Sie SQL2REST 30 Tage kostenlos und prüfen Sie, ob ein MCP Server für Ihre JTL-Wawi den Arbeitsablauf Ihres Teams verbessert.

Bereit, Ihre JTL-Wawi Daten als API zu nutzen?

Starten Sie in wenigen Minuten — keine komplizierte Einrichtung, keine Cloud-Abhängigkeit.